Transaction 5c304586bbe697e6cb86b4ce077105f638440c7a61f4f873ca37652eae710ae7

4 Input
2 Outputs
  • 5c304586bbe697e6cb86b4ce077105f638440c7a61f4f873ca37652eae710ae7:0
  • value  3240554
    address  3CFKimC99ZTHztvCfQF9WnUQKr2dhrm4Tz
  • 5c304586bbe697e6cb86b4ce077105f638440c7a61f4f873ca37652eae710ae7:1
  • value  998066
    address  34gPUgHS2vYHAnbbK1zmFCtYDZM1eSAasX